Authentication Bypass Vulnerability in NETGEAR Routers
CVE-2021-45500
9.6CRITICAL
Summary
Certain NETGEAR routers are susceptible to an authentication bypass flaw that allows unauthorized access to the device. This vulnerability affects the R7000P model prior to version 1.3.3.140 and the R8000 model before version 1.0.4.68. Exploiting this vulnerability could allow an attacker to bypass authentication measures and gain control over the router, potentially compromising the network's security. Users are advised to update their devices to the latest firmware to mitigate the risks associated with this vulnerability.
